About this route:
A direct, nonstop flight between Texarkana Regional Airport (TXK), Texarkana, Arkansas, United States and Syamsudin Noor International Airport (SNA) (BDJ), Banjarmasin, South Kalimantan, Indonesia would travel a Great Circle distance of 9,656 miles (or 15,539 kilometers).
A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the large distance between Texarkana Regional Airport and Syamsudin Noor International Airport (SNA), the route shown on this map most likely appears curved because of this reason.

Facts about Texarkana Regional Airport (TXK):
- As per Federal Aviation Administration records, the airport had 29,820 passenger boardings in calendar year 2008, 26,759 enplanements in 2009, and 26,690 in 2010.
- Because of Texarkana Regional Airport's relatively low elevation of 390 feet, planes can take off or land at Texarkana Regional Airport at a lower air speed than at airports located at a higher elevation. This is because the air density is higher closer to sea level than it would otherwise be at higher elevations.
- In addition to being known as "Texarkana Regional Airport", another name for TXK is "Webb Field".
- Texarkana Regional Airport (TXK) has 2 runways.
- The closest airport to Texarkana Regional Airport (TXK) is Magnolia Municipal Airport (AGO), which is located 47 miles (76 kilometers) ESE of TXK.

Facts about Syamsudin Noor International Airport (SNA) (BDJ):
- Syamsudin Noor International Airport (SNA) (BDJ) currently has only 1 runway.
- In August 2012, about 58 hectares of 102 hectares of the land needed for an expansion had been acquired.
- Because of Syamsudin Noor International Airport (SNA)'s relatively low elevation of 66 feet, planes can take off or land at Syamsudin Noor International Airport (SNA) at a lower air speed than at airports located at a higher elevation. This is because the air density is higher closer to sea level than it would otherwise be at higher elevations.
- The closest airport to Syamsudin Noor International Airport (SNA) (BDJ) is Batu Licin Airport (BTW), which is located 85 miles (137 kilometers) E of BDJ.
- In addition to being known as "Syamsudin Noor International Airport (SNA)", other names for BDJ include "Bandar Udara Internasional Syamsudin Noor (SNA)" and "WAOO".
